AZTEK Pro Series LT System

Originally developed by Reed Thorne of Arizona-based Ropes That Rescue, the AZTEK (Arizona Technician’s Edge Kit) is used globally and offers more than 100 rigging solutions in a bag. As one of the most versatile tools used in rope rescue, the system reflects the philosophy of keeping rigging equipment simple, efficient, non-specialized, light and small. The design of the CMC AZTEK ProSeries LT System (Load Tender) leaves no detail ignored. The more compact ‘LT’ version of the AZTEK offers 28 feet of 8 mm AZTEK ProSeries Cord that can extend the set-of-fours up to 6 feet, providing a 4:1 or 5:1 mechanical advantage with a minimum breaking strength (MBS) of 38 kN (8,542 lbf). The LT system includes (2) ProTech Aluminum Auto-Lock Carabiners w/ removable keeper pin – 29 kN (6,519 lbf) for attaching to the swivel ends. CMC G11 Lifeline

Introducing the first NFPA, G-rated 11 mm rope, made from traditional fibers. This low-stretch Kernmantle rope constructed with a polyester sheath and nylon core offers maximum strength in a lightweight and easy to handle rope. G11™ Lifeline is ideal for rope rescue and rope access operations providing enhanced safety, performance and superior knotability. G11 is constructed with 32 carrier, tandem bobbin, sheath braiding that is optimized for high strength, reduced diameter, and minimal elongation.

New England Ropes KM III

A superior handling rescue rope, New England Ropes KM III static kernmantle rope features composite construction, with the continuous filament polyester sheath braided over a continuous nylon fiber core. Featuring a weight-balanced construction with the sheath and the core each representing half the total weight, KM III is torque-balanced to eliminate any spin during a rappel. This provides excellent handling and knot-holding characteristics, as well as rugged protection from abrasion and cutting. The polyester sheath provides added protection from ultraviolet light and chemicals harmful to nylon, while reducing the strength loss and weight gain that occurs when nylon absorbs water. Static-Pro Lifeline

An extremely low-stretch kernmantle rescue lifeline constructed of 100% High Tenacity Polyester (HTP) fiber. The polyester fibers do not absorb water, so there is no loss of strength or increase in weight if the rope gets wet. With less than 2% stretch at 300 lbf, Static-Pro is an excellent choice for high lines, long rappels, and many mechanical advantage haul systems. Polyester fiber ropes have better resistance to acids than nylon, which makes Static-Pro the preferred choice in acidic environments. Favored for its excellent hand, knotability and UV resistance, Static-Pro Lifelines come in solid colors with a single stripe to prevent confusion with CMC Lifeline and other solid color kernmantle ropes. *Rope is sold by the foot. Flat Web

We’ve been using our one-inch flat web in our rescue classes for several years and it’s proven to be an excellent performer. While not all flat webs will hold knots securely, the CMC Rescue Flat Webbing has been specifically selected for the suppleness necessary to allow knots to be set securely. Flat web also tends to be easier to untie after a heavy load than the softer tubular web. While the flat web is bulkier than the tubular, it does provide a significantly higher strength.
